Comparing Bipod Designs: Adjustable vs. Fixed

When choosing a bipod with your firearm , examine the significant distinction between adjustable and fixed types. Fixed bipods provide simplicity and durability , often for a decreased cost , but miss the flexibility to handle varying landscapes. Conversely , variable bipods permit you to alter the elevation to suit different shooting setups, improving precision or offering a greater tailored firing setup.

Combat Mounts Features and Operation

Contemporary tactical bipods have evolved significantly, offering shooters increased balance and targeting during prolonged firing positions . These devices typically incorporate adjustable leg height settings to accommodate different terrain situations . Several also present pan and tilt capabilities, allowing for adaptable target acquisition . Typical construction materials involve resilient alloys like titanium , ensuring longevity even in harsh settings . Moreover , some variants boast quick- release mechanisms for convenience of attachment and disassembly .
